Relationship Between Health Anxiety and the Motivations of the Health Programs Monitoring by Hospitalized Patients

Objective: It is stated that individuals with high health anxiety mostly prefer to receive information from sources such as internet and television instead of getting help from health personnel. The information sources can seriously impare functionality by further increasing patient\'s anxiety. In this study, it was aimed to determine the relationship between health anxiety and motivations of health programs monitoring by hospitalized patients in medical and surgical clinics in a hospital.

Material and Method: The study included 199 patients who were hospitalized at medical and surgical clinics. Demographic Information Form, Health Anxiety Scale (HAS) and Health Program Viewing Motivation Scale (HPVMS) were used to collect data. In evaluating the data; descriptive statistics were used as well as Pearson Correlation Analysis, Mann Whitney U Test and Kruskal Wallis Test.

Results: It was determined that being female, having a chronic disease, using drugs, viewing health programs and perception of having poor socioe-conomic level increase a mean total score of the HAS of patients at statistical significance (p <0,05). In addition, a strong correlation was found between the HPVMS scores of patients and dimension of hypersensitivity of physical symptoms and anxiety, while a moderate relation was found between the HPVMS scores and dimension of negative results of disease (r =0,951, p <0,001; r =0,621, p <0,001, respectively).

Conclusion: This study showed that there is a relationship between the HAS scores and the HPVMS scores in hospitalized patients in internal and surgical clinics. It has been proposed to determine the level of health anxiety of patients in medical and surgical clinics.
